Characteristics of fitness sneakers
- Materials: The uppers of quality running shoes are usually made from breathable synthetic mesh or a combination of mesh and suede/leather. Such materials are highly breathable and dry quickly after sweating. The sole should be made of wear-resistant rubber or EVA for durability. The insole is made of foam material for shock absorption.
- Wear resistance: The tread on the sole of the sneaker should be deep and textured to provide good grip. High friction areas are reinforced with stronger materials.
- Cushioning: High-quality foam cushioning cushions the impact of running or jumping, reducing stress on your joints.
- Foot Support: A heel reinforcement helps keep your foot in place, while a molded plastic midfoot provides extra support when changing direction.
- Ventilation: Breathable upper material, perforations and special mesh inserts ensure air circulation inside the sneaker.
- Grip: The deep, soft rubber outsole provides reliable grip on any surface in the gym.
How to choose the perfect sneakers?
- Determine the purpose of training: Before choosing running shoes, it is important to determine what exercises they will be used for. For cardio you need good shock absorption, for strength training you need stability and grip during sudden movements, for functional training you need versatility.
- Consider your foot type: Running shoes have varying degrees of pronation (rotation of the foot when walking). Neutral pronation requires a neutral block, excessive pronation requires a stabilizing block.
- Trying on and walking test: The most important thing is to try on the sneakers. They shouldn't be tight, but they shouldn't be loose either. Walk around the store in them, sit down. The sneaker should neither squeeze nor slide off the foot.
- Size and fit: Select the size according to your longest foot with a margin of 0.5-1 cm to the toes. The space above the toes should be snug, but not too tight.

Sneaker care
- Post-workout cleaning: Be sure to clean the surface of your running shoes after each intense workout with a damp cloth or sponge. This will extend their service life.
- Drying: Do not dry your sneakers on a radiator or other heat source. This may damage the materials. Dry them at room temperature.
- Storage: Store sneakers in a ventilated place to allow them to breathe. Mold may form in closed plastic boxes.
How often should you change your fitness sneakers?
The optimal period for using sneakers is 6-12 months with regular intense training. If the sole has worn out and lost its texture, it’s time to change your shoes.
Are running shoes good for fitness?
Running models have more camber in the midfoot for cushioning when running. Many fitness exercises require a flatter, stable platform.
How to determine your type of foot pronation?
Take a shower and stand on a paper towel. Neutral pronation corresponds to an oval imprint. If only the outline of the foot is visible, this is supination. The imprint of the entire foot is pronation.
